Slow Cooker BBQ Pineapple Meatballs

These easy and tasty Slow Cooker BBQ Pineapple Meatballs combine premade meatballs, fresh pineapple, and BBQ sauce for a delicious dish that's perfect for any occasion.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 4 hours
Total Time 4 hours 10 minutes
Servings: 6 servings
Course: Appetizer, Main Course
Cuisine: American
Calories: 240

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ients
  • 24 oz premade meatballs Use frozen premade meatballs to save time.
  • 1 cup fresh pineapple, diced Cut into bite-size pieces for even heating.
  • 1 cup bbq sauce You can use a mix of sweet and spicy BBQ sauce.
  • 2 tbsp honey Optional, adds sweetness.
  • 1 tbsp hot sauce Optional, for added heat.

Method
 

Cooking
  1. Place the premade meatballs and fresh pineapple in the slow cooker.
  2. Pour the BBQ sauce over the meatballs and pineapple.
  3. If desired, add a little honey and a few dashes of hot sauce.
  4. Cover and cook on low for 4-6 hours or high for 2-3 hours.
  5. Serve warm.

Notes

Let the meatballs cool before storing in an airtight container. Store in the fridge for up to 3 days or freeze for up to 3 months. Thaw in the fridge before reheating.
